It's Gucci Time (Six Months in Lockdown)
Oy vey. Now Gucci Mane's going to jail for an unnamed probation violations. Another rapper at a prime moment in his career, self-waylaid on his way to a big release date. And this is the second time this has happened to the 29-year-old Gucci-four years ago, the buzz from his first hit, "Icy" was squelched when he was arrested on a murder charge that was eventually dropped. He later did jail time for, um, forgetting to do 600 hours of community service on an assault charge. Busy, busy!
